Enhancement of Neuroimmune Diagnosis by Artificial Intelligence
摘要
Neuro-immunology is a rapidly evolving area of research focusing on the intersection between the immune and nervous systems. The immune system plays a crucial role in the pathogenesis of various neurological disorders, including multiple sclerosis, autoimmune encephalitis, and neuroinflammatory diseases. Accurate diagnosis and treatment of these conditions are paramount to improving patient outcomes. In recent years, artificial intelligence (AI) has revolutionised medicine, including neuro-immunology. AI has the potential to greatly enhance the accuracy and efficiency of diagnosis, as well as aid in the development of personalised treatment strategies. In this chapter, we will explore the various applications of AI in neuroimmune diagnosis and therapy, highlighting its current and future potential. Accurate diagnosis is the foundation of effective treatment in neuro-immunology. However, diagnosing neuro-immunological disorders can be challenging due to their complex and heterogeneous nature. AI can process large amounts of data and extract patterns and insights that may need to be more easily discernible to human clinicians.
